Though the Arboreans seem to have been voted highly, to answer some of the Arboreal detractors or competitive concerns, I propose bringing in Haleheim as an alternative theme:

Haleheim (Hale, a derivative of an old Norse term meaning hearty, strong, stout). A down to earth team with an emphasis on physical strength, arms, armor.:

Main thematic path: Earth

Secondary thematic path: Fire

Other associated themes: Seigecraft, forging

Recommended nations (in order of relevance): Ulm, Agartha, Machaka, Ashdod, Shinuyama, Vanheim.

After considering the matter, and though I don't like limited choice, I think it may be best to go with pre-set nations for game 2 for several reasons:

1. Preserves themes
2. Eliminates the whole nation selection process, saving time.
3. Let's Gandalf know which nations he has to work with in advance.

Consider the following hypothetical matchup(s) then:

Haleheim: Ulm, Agartha, Ashdod, Marginon (or less relative but very versatile Arco).

Sanguinarium: Abysia, Jotunheim, Pangaea, Vanheim.

Supplicants of Set: Ermor, Shinuyama, C'tis, Machaka.

Usurpers: Pythium, Bandar Log, Mictlan, Arco (or R'lyeh, MA R'lyeh is very thematic for this team and can be included with certain caveats).

This would leave Man, Eriu, T'ien Chi', to form the basis of a largely possibly Arboreal themed AI team.

Balance experts and others, comments, criticism, suggestions?
